The Evolution from Physical Casinos to Digital Platforms
Historically, land-based casinos offered a social, tactile experience rooted in glamour and exclusivity. However, the limitations of geography, operating hours, and logistical constraints have often hindered widespread access. The advent of online gambling in the early 2000s marked a pivotal turning point, enabling players to engage with casino games via their computers and, later, mobile devices.
Today, the global online gambling market is projected to exceed $80 billion by 2025, according to industry analysts such as Statista and H2 Gambling Capital. This growth is fueled by a surge in internet penetration, technological innovations like augmented reality (AR), virtual reality (VR), and sophisticated randomization algorithms that ensure fairness and unpredictability.

Regulatory Environment and Consumer Trust
As the industry matures, regulatory bodies across the UK, Europe, and beyond have implemented rigorous standards to safeguard players and ensure fair play. These include licensing, audit protocols, and responsible gaming initiatives. Such measures are vital to maintaining industry credibility and countering perceptions of illegitimacy.
Spotlight on Industry Innovation: From RNG to Live Dealer Games
| Feature | Description | Impact on User Experience |
|---|---|---|
| Random Number Generators (RNG) | Ensure game randomness and fairness, used in slots and digital table games. | Built trust in game integrity |
| Live Dealer Games | Streamed, real-time dealer interactions via high-quality video feeds. | Enhanced realism and social engagement |
| Gamification & Virtual Rewards | Implementing loyalty points, tournaments, and interactive challenges. | Drive engagement and repeat gameplay |
